Background
CDKN2A/p16INK4A is a critical tumor suppressor protein encoded by the CDKN2A gene that functions as a key negative regulator of the cell cycle by specifically inhibiting cyclin-dependent kinases 4 and 6 (CDK4/6), thereby preventing the phosphorylation of the retinoblastoma protein (Rb) and arresting cell progression from the G1 to the S phase to curb uncontrolled proliferation. Often referred to as p16, this protein acts as a vital checkpoint against oncogenic transformation, and its loss of function through genetic deletion, mutation, or epigenetic silencing is a hallmark event in numerous human cancers, including melanoma, pancreatic ductal adenocarcinoma, and glioblastoma; conversely, its overexpression is frequently observed in cells undergoing senescence or in HPV-associated malignancies where it serves as a reliable diagnostic biomarker due to the disruption of the Rb pathway by viral oncoproteins, making p16INK4A not only a fundamental component of cellular defense mechanisms but also a significant target for therapeutic strategies and prognostic assessments in oncology.
